     417  0 Kommentare Alamos Gold Announces Acquisition of Manitou Gold More Than Tripling Land Package Adjacent to Island Gold Mine

    TORONTO, Feb. 28,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Alamos Gold Inc. (TSX:AGI; NYSE:AGI) (“Alamos” or the “Company”) is pleased to announce that it has entered into a definitive agreement (the “Agreement”) pursuant to which Alamos will acquire all of the issued and outstanding shares of Manitou Gold Inc. (TSX:MTU) (“Manitou”) by way of a court-approved plan of arrangement (the “Transaction”). The acquisition will consolidate Alamos’ existing ownership of Manitou shares and increase its regional land package around Island Gold with the addition of the Goudreau Property. This includes 40,000 hectares (“ha”) adjacent to and along strike from the Island Gold Mine, adding significant exploration potential across the relatively underexplored Michipicoten Greenstone Belt (see Figure 1). This is expected to increase Alamos’ land package around the Island Gold Deposit to 55,277 ha, a 267% increase.

    The acquisition extends Alamos’ mineral tenure along strike to the east within the Goudreau Lake Deformation Zone, a primary control on gold mineralization within the Goudreau-Lochalsh segment of the Michipicoten Greenstone Belt. The expanded land package will now include the majority of the mineral tenure between the only two major mines within the belt – the Island Gold Mine and the past producing Renabie Gold Mine (aggregate production of 1.1 million ounces of gold from 1947-1991). The Goudreau Property also adds six additional belt-scale deformation zones hosting several gold occurrences, including Cradle Lake-Emily Bay, Loch Lomond, Missinaibi, Baltimore, Easy Lake and Renabie Deformation Zones.

    Alamos has developed a systematic district-scale targeting and exploration approach for the area surrounding the Island Gold Mine. This approach can now be applied to the larger consolidated land package to rapidly generate and test new exploration targets.

    Under the terms of the Agreement, Manitou shareholders will receive 0.003525 of an Alamos common share for each Manitou share, representing a value of C$0.05 per Manitou share, calculated based on the 20-day volume weighted average trading price of Alamos’ shares on the Toronto Stock Exchange immediately preceding February 28, 2023. This represents a premium of 95% based on Alamos’ and Manitou’s respective closing prices on February 27, 2023 and 88% premium to Manitou’s 20-day volume-weighted average price. Alamos currently owns 65.2 million Manitou shares, representing approximately 19% of Manitou’s basic common shares outstanding. Excluding Alamos’ existing ownership of Manitou, Alamos expects to issue approximately 1.0 million shares for total consideration of C$14 million.
